Seminole senior baseball player Corey Baptist, who transferred from St. Petersburg Catholic, has committed to play at Mississippi next fall, according to Warhawks coach Jeff Pincus. As a junior, Baptist hit .316 with 17 RBIs and a team-high four home runs.
Baptist played first base for the Barons and helped them to a 20-10-1 record and an appearance in the state championship game. Pincus said he does not know which position Baptist will play for the Warhawks.
Mississippi was 37-26 overall in 2012, 14-16 in the SEC.
